Danish Design — What’s it all about?
Danes love designer products – everything from light fittings, coffee thermoses and door handles to bicycles and furniture. Not necessarily because it is new design, but usually because it is good design which is functional in daily use as well as beautiful to look at. Beginning in the 1950’s, a group of uncompromising danish architects revolutionized the remainder of that era with simplicity and functionalism. These innovative Danes focused on good materials and craftsmanship, and created designs which are still admired and valued today.
“Functional design propels me not just to have a better life but to accomplish more” – Karim Rashid, Designer
Trinidad was designed in 1993 by Nanna Ditzel. The chair’s distinctive fan-shaped design made it instantly successful for both home and contract, a status it still enjoys today. The Trinidad is available with or without upholstered seats, and with or without arms, as well as a bar stool version.
The idea of keeping things simple to make them affordable to the majority is also in line with the humanistic and democratic currents which have characterized Danish society.
The Wishbone Chair is perhaps Wegner’s most celebrated work. A light, attractive and comfortable dining chair with the characteristic Y-shaped back. The chair is a triumph of craftsmanship with a simple design and clean lines. Hans J. Wegner designed the Wishbone chair for Carl Hansen & Søn in 1949 and it has been in continuous production since 1950.
Danish design is about more than just furniture design. Internationally renowned Danish design companies include Rosendahl Copenhagen with their innovative designs in housewares, Royal Copenhagen with their popular porcelain series, and Bang & Olufsen, who create television, radio and music systems with iconic status.
